Federal agencies overseeing water safety compliance
Several federal agencies play a vital role in overseeing water safety compliance under US water resources law. The Environmental Protection Agency (EPA) is the primary agency responsible for establishing national standards for drinking and recreational water quality. It administers regulations such as the Safe Drinking Water Act (SDWA), which sets enforceable standards to protect public health. The EPA also coordinates efforts to prevent waterborne diseases and monitor contaminants in public water systems.
Additionally, the U.S. Army Corps of Engineers and the Bureau of Reclamation oversee water infrastructure projects, ensuring compliance with federal safety standards. These agencies manage large-scale water resource developments, including dams, reservoirs, and water treatment facilities. Their oversight ensures that infrastructure maintains safety and operational integrity in accordance with water safety regulations.
While the EPA provides overarching policies, federal agencies work collaboratively with other entities like the Centers for Disease Control and Prevention (CDC) to support public health initiatives. Overall, these federal agencies form the backbone of water safety enforcement, ensuring compliance with water safety regulations to protect public health and water resources nationwide.

Water Safety Regulations for Recreational Waters
Water safety regulations for recreational waters are critical in ensuring the health and safety of the public. These regulations establish standards for water quality, which are regularly monitored to prevent contamination and eliminate health risks. Compliance with these standards is essential to safeguarding swimmers and users of recreational water bodies.
Regulatory frameworks mandate routine water testing for pathogens, chemicals, and pollutants. They specify acceptable levels for bacteria such as E. coli and Enterococci, which are indicators of fecal contamination. These standards help to identify potential health hazards early and prevent outbreaks of waterborne diseases.
In addition to water quality, regulations also govern the management of recreational water facilities. This includes implementing proper sanitation, controlling algae blooms, and maintaining physical infrastructure like filtration and drainage systems. These measures work together to provide a safe and hygienic environment for public use.
Enforcement of these regulations involves routine inspections and public health advisories when water quality issues are detected. Failure to comply can result in penalties or closure of facilities. These regulations play a vital role in protecting public health and maintaining trust in recreational water resources.

Reducing waterborne disease outbreaks
Effective water safety regulations are critical in minimizing the incidence of waterborne disease outbreaks. By establishing strict standards for water treatment and sanitation, these regulations ensure that water supplies remain free from pathogenic microorganisms. This proactive approach reduces the risk of contamination that could lead to health crises.
Regulatory frameworks mandate routine water quality testing, which provides continuous monitoring for microbes such as bacteria, viruses, and protozoa. Early detection through testing allows for prompt corrective actions, preventing contaminated water from reaching consumers. This systematic process significantly curtails potential outbreaks of diseases like cholera, dysentery, and hepatitis A.
Additionally, implementing comprehensive source protection measures is vital. These include safeguarding water sources from pollution and regulating agricultural runoff, industrial discharges, and sewage disposal. By controlling pollution at the source, water safety regulations proactively prevent the introduction of harmful pathogens into the water supply, further reducing disease risks.
Overall, the enforcement of water safety regulations plays a fundamental role in reducing waterborne disease outbreaks. They ensure that water remains safe for public consumption, thereby protecting community health and maintaining trust in water supply systems.
